Spraying equipment of enamel plate
Technical Field
The utility model relates to an enamel plate makes technical field, especially relates to an enamel plate's spraying equipment.
Background
The enamel plate has wide application in daily life due to the beautiful appearance, easy cleaning and corrosion resistance. The process for manufacturing the enamel plate comprises the steps of firstly manufacturing metal into a metal plate, then spraying enamel glaze on the surface of the metal plate, and then sintering the enamel glaze to form the enamel plate.
In the prior art, enamel glaze is generally sprayed on a metal plate by a manual handheld spray gun. The manual spraying mode is adopted, the labor amount of operators is large, the labor intensity is high, dust generated in the spraying treatment process causes great damage to the bodies of the operators, the operators are easily infected with occupational diseases which are difficult to cure, and economic and mental injuries are caused to the operators. In addition, the manual spraying mode has low productivity, and the spraying effect is determined by the proficiency of operators, so the consistency of the products after the spraying treatment is poor, and the product quality cannot be guaranteed.

Detailed Description
Referring to fig. 1, the utility model discloses a spraying equipment of enamel plate, including frame 1, locate the transfer chain 2 of 1 front end of frame and locate control box 4 and photoelectric sensor 5 of 1 rear end of frame, transfer chain 2 can hang about metal sheet 11 and drive metal sheet 11, photoelectric sensor 5 can respond to the position of metal sheet 11, the rear end of frame 1 still is equipped with at least one spray gun 3, spray gun 3 can reciprocate to spray enamel glaze to metal sheet 11's surface, transfer chain 2, spray gun 3 and photoelectric sensor 5 all with 4 electric connection of control box.
Specifically, the conveying line 2 drives the metal plate 11 to move towards the direction of the spray gun 3, the photoelectric sensor 5 transmits a signal back to the control box 4 after sensing the metal plate 11, the control box 4 controls the spray gun 3 to move up and down, and enamel glaze is sprayed on the surface of the metal plate 11; the conveyor line 2 drives the metal plate 11 to move continuously, and when the photoelectric sensor 5 cannot sense the metal plate 11, the spray gun 3 stops spraying the enamel glaze and stops moving.
In this embodiment, two spray guns 3 are provided to meet the thickness requirement of the enamel on the metal plate 11. The spray gun 3 can carry out automatic spraying to the metal sheet 11, reduces manual operation, to workman's injury greatly reduced, efficient moreover, the uniformity is good, guarantees product quality.
Further referring to fig. 3, the spray gun 3 includes a gun body 31, a nozzle 32 is disposed at the front end of the gun body 31, a feed inlet 33 is disposed at the rear end of the nozzle 32, an air inlet 34 is disposed at the rear end of the gun body 31, the feed inlet 33 and the air inlet 34 are respectively provided with a feed valve 35 and an air inlet valve 36, and the feed valve 35 and the air inlet valve 36 are both electrically connected to the control box 4. When the spray gun 3 sprays the enamel glaze, the feeding valve 35 and the air inlet valve 36 are both opened, the enamel glaze enters the spray nozzle 32 from the feeding hole 33, the high-pressure gas enters the gun body 31 from the air inlet 34, and the enamel glaze in the spray nozzle 32 is sprayed to the metal plate 11 under the pressure of the high-pressure gas in the gun body 31.
Referring to fig. 2 again, the glaze discharging device further comprises a charging basket 6, a glaze pump 61 is arranged at the upper end of the charging basket 6, a discharging port of the glaze pump 61 is communicated with a feeding port 33 of the spray gun 3 through a material pipe 7, and a feeding port of the glaze pump 61 is communicated with the charging basket 6. The spray gun is characterized by further comprising an air pump 10, wherein an air outlet of the air pump 10 is communicated with an air inlet of the spray gun 3 through an air pipe 8, and an air inlet of the air pump 10 is communicated with an air source. The control box 4 changes the flow rate and pressure of the enamel and the gas by controlling the rotation speed of the glaze pump 61 and the air pump 10 to control the thickness of the enamel sprayed from the spray gun 3 to the metal plate 11.
And, be equipped with elevating system 9 on the frame 1, the output of elevating system 9 is located to spray gun 3. Elevating system 9 includes first chain and two first gears that set up from top to bottom, first chain cover is established on two first gears, and one of them first gear is by motor drive, elevating system still includes vertical slide rail 91 that sets up in the frame, the place ahead of first chain is located to slide rail 91, the correspondence is equipped with slider 92 on the slide rail 91, slider 92 and first chain fixed connection, be equipped with support 94 on the slider 92, spray gun 3 installs on support 94. The sliding block 92 is further provided with a cross rod 93, and the middle parts of the material pipe 7 and the air pipe 8 are hung on the cross rod 93.
In addition, the conveying line 2 comprises a second chain 21 and two second gears 22 arranged on the left and right, the second chain 21 is sleeved on the two second gears 22, and one of the second gears 22 is driven by a motor. The second chain 21 is provided with a hook 23, the hook 23 is hung with a hanger 24, the hanger 24 is connected with the metal plate 11, the hanger 24 is provided with a through hole, and one end of the hook 23 can penetrate through the through hole.
